00问答网
所有问题
当前搜索:
insert select
insert
into a
select
* from b 和select * into a from b 这两个语 ...
答:
这怎么能一样呢。第一个是你批量把B表的数据插到A表,后者这个是应该放在过程里面的吧。你你是把A表的数据存入一个变量,不过,你这么写,估计会报错的。但是这二个意思绝对不一样。很大的区别。
insert
into
select
可以加where条件么
答:
可以的,where条件用来限制查询出来的数据,然后将这部分数据插入到你指定的表中
关于
insert
into 里,带条件判断的sql语句怎么写?
答:
1、方法一 IF NOT EXISTS(
SELECT
* FROM TABLE_NAME WHERE FILED1 = 1 ) THEN
INSERT
INTO TABLE_NAME VALUES(1 2、将要插入的数据先写入临时表,然后用 INSERT INTO TABLE_NAME SELECT * FROM #TEMP_TABLE A LEFT JOIN TABLE_NAME ON A.FILED1 = B.FIELD1 WHERE B.FILED1 IS NULL ...
db2数据库,
insert
into a表
select
* from b表 能不能设置每1000_百度...
答:
这种写法是不能分批提交的,除非你用where条件+循环自己实现分批处理。
insert
into ...
select
的语法效率是很高的,不过数据量过大时需要很大的回滚段。分批提交适用于游标逐行处理的情况,没到1000行提交一次,会比每行提交效率提高很多。
dml是什么?
答:
DML是Data Manipulation Language的缩写,意思是数据操纵语言,是指在SQL语言中,负责对数据库对象运行数据访问工作的指令集,以
INSERT
、UPDATE、DELETE三种指令为核心,分别代表插入、更新与删除,是开发以数据为中心的应用程序必定会使用到的指令。1、主条目:INSERT,INSERT是将数据插入到数据库对象中的指令...
Sql server 2008学习了一个星期,可是感觉自己好笨,怎么也学不会,自己...
答:
所以建议使用文件组管理。9.开发人员规范 ①写
INSERT
以及
SELECT
要写明具体字段名称,否则一旦表字段进行了调整,就会带来修改客户端程序的麻烦。②存储过程名称不要以sp_开头,而要以usp_开头。因为sp_开头的存储过程会被当做系统自带内容,降低性能。
delete+
insert
与
select
+update哪个效率高
答:
看数据量和字段多少而定,如果字段少,数据量大的话,就用delete+
insert
,一般是5个以内的我才这样做,而且数据量稍微有点做的情况下,如果字段多,不管数据量有多少,一般都是
select
+update
insert
into语句怎么用?
答:
修改数据库:ALTER DATABASE 创建新表:CREATE TABLE 变更(改变)数据库表:ALTER TABLE 删除表:DROP TABLE 创建索引(搜索键):CREATE INDEX 删除索引:DROP INDEX 删除主键:Alter table tabname drop primary key(col)选择:
select
* from table1 where 范围 插入:
insert
into table1(field1,...
insert
into 语句怎么写?(Sqlserver)
答:
这里由于可以指定插入到talbe2中的列,以及可以通过相对较复杂的查询语句进行数据源获取,可能使用起来会更加的灵活,但我们也必须注意,在指定目标表的列时,一定要将所有非空列都填上,否则将无法进行数据插入。容易出错的地方,当我们写成如下方式3的变形简写格式:变形:
INSERT
INTOt2
SELECT
id,name,...
oracle 存储过程中 使用
insert
into Table (
select
) 进行数据批量添加...
答:
存贮过程运行了吗?不会是只创建了事吧!
首页
<上一页
5
6
7
8
10
11
12
9
13
14
下一页
尾页
其他人还搜